In 1998 Cal Ripken, Jr. ended his consecutive game streak. He started at 3B for the Orioles in 161 games. Who started at 3B the only other game that year, played the game in it's entirety, and thus ending Ripken's streak?

It was Minor. I was at that game, actually.  I remember they didn't even announce the lineups that night.  They just posted them on the scoreboard about ten minutes prior to game time and let the crowd figure it out on it's own.  I think I was the first person in my section who actually noticed.  There may be some selective memory in there but I think that's pretty much how it happened.
